INSTALLAING THE CONTROL CENTRE
Select a suitable location for the control centre. The location of the
control centre can greatly affect its performance. If it is located where
air circulation cannot reach, or exposed to direct sun light, it will not
adjust the room temperature properly.
To ensure proper operation, the control centre should be installed
at an inside wall with freely circulating air. Find a place where your
family is usually occupied.
Avoid close proximity to heat generating appliances (e.g. TV, heater,
refrigerator) or exposed to direct sunlight. Do not install near a door
where the thermostat will suffer from vibration.
Using the template provided, drill two ø6mm holes in the wall. Insert
the wall anchors and tighten the left screw with 3mm clearance. Fix the
control centre by putting it over the screwhead and slide it rightward
(note the keyhole-like opening at the back of the thermostat). Tighten
the remain screw to lock it in place.
Note: If the wall is made of wood, there is no need to use the wall
anchors. Drill two ø2.7mm holes instead of ø6mm.
